Dumped Lib Jessica Whelan facing suit over ‘dirt file’ claim

Labor leader Rebecca White has threatened legal action against dumped Liberal candidate Jessica Whelan.

Tasmanian Labor leader Rebecca White has threatened legal action against dumped Liberal candidate Jessica Whelan over her claims that Ms White distributed a “dirt file” on her.

The Australian understands Ms White has threatened proceedings against Ms Whelan, who resigned as the Liberal candidate for the seat of Lyons last week over anti-Islamic social media posts, unless she withdraws the claim.

Their potential legal stoush is understood to relate to comments Ms Whelan made in a radio interview on Monday with Brian Carlton on Tasmania Talks when she ­accused the state Opposition Leader of forwarding “a dirt file” to journalists.

Ms White, who raised in state parliament anti-Islamic Facebook posts she attributed to Ms Whelan, yesterday firmly denied distributing any “dirt file”.

She confirmed she was taking legal steps.

“Jessica Whelan has made allegations against me that are patently false,” she said. “I am taking steps to ensure the record is corrected and that those statements are not repeated.”

Ms Whelan, now contesting the seat as an independent, has admitted to making Facebook posts several years ago suggesting Muslims should not come to Australia.

Yesterday, she told The Australian she was “unable to comment” on Ms White’s legal manoeuvres “while awaiting legal advice”.
